Transaction 7c753dae30c8ae432fa082fc7928f5ca874a16f380f74534b06f28b1d6358131

1 Input
2 Outputs
  • 7c753dae30c8ae432fa082fc7928f5ca874a16f380f74534b06f28b1d6358131:0
  • value  7716907357
    address  2MsW22LchaZjvS6X89SHDSr1fjXt9dzeabR
  • 7c753dae30c8ae432fa082fc7928f5ca874a16f380f74534b06f28b1d6358131:1
  • value  1298629
    address  2MwJJXQaThtKxs1x7c96vTmFgzmMjMFHSJS